Abstract
The use of nonlinear sum frequency generation by mixing of GaAlAs laser diode emission with 1064-nm Nd:YAG output offers an efficient method for producing coherent radiation in the 450-480-nm spectral region, a range which is not easily accessible with frequency doubled laser diodes. Previously this method was used with KNbO3 in a single pass configuration,1 and KTP placed inside a dye laser pumped Nd:YAG laser cavity2 which resulted in 1.0 mW of 459-nm emission.
